The conscious mind is often described as the part of our mental processing that we are aware of. It is responsible for logical reasoning, decision-making, and self-awareness. On the other hand, the subconscious mind operates below the level of conscious awareness and influences our thoughts, feelings, and behavior in powerful ways. In Sweden, there is a growing interest in practices such as mindfulness and meditation, which can help individuals access their subconscious mind and tap into its full potential. By quieting the chatter of the conscious mind and tuning into the deeper layers of awareness, people can gain valuable insights, enhance their creativity, and overcome limiting beliefs. One practice that is popular in Sweden is hypnotherapy, which involves guiding individuals into a relaxed state where the subconscious mind becomes more receptive to positive suggestions and affirmations. This can be particularly helpful for overcoming phobias, changing negative habits, and improving overall well-being. Another way to explore the connection between the conscious and subconscious mind is through dream analysis. In Sweden, there is a long tradition of studying dreams as a means of accessing the hidden depths of the psyche. By paying attention to dream symbols, emotions, and themes, individuals can gain a deeper understanding of their inner world and uncover valuable insights that can guide them in their waking life.
